THE MINISTER FOR LATRINES

Tory Mellor: Green not fit for Cabinet

- BY BEN GLAZE Deputy Political Editor ben.glaze@mirror.co.uk

A FORMER Tory Cabinet Minister said under-fire Damian Green should have quit immediatel­y and would have been Minister for Toilets under Margaret Thatcher.

Ex-national Heritage Secretary David Mellor launched a blistering attack on Theresa May’s number two, who faces calls to step aside while an inquiry into his conduct continues.

Mr Mellor, who resigned in 1992 after a sleaze scandal, claimed First Secretary of State Mr Green would not be missed for a “millisecon­d”.

The de-facto deputy PM has been accused of having pornograph­y on a computer in his Commons office in 2008.

He is also alleged to have sent an inappropri­ate text message to a Conservati­ve activist 30 years his junior – and touched her knee.

Mr Green, who is the subject of a Cabinet Office inquiry, has strongly denied downloadin­g or watching porn on the computer, or behaving inappropri­ately towards Kate Maltby.

Mr Mellor said yesterday: “Damian Green should have said, ‘I will resign to clear my name’ and he would have had lots of sympathy.”

He went on: “Damian Green is the sort of guy who, under Mrs Thatcher, would have been the Minister of State for Latrines and would have lived in total obscurity. Instead of which, he becomes Deputy Prime Minister, he rises without trace.

“He would not be missed for a millisecon­d if he left government. It would be better if he did.”
